Biochemical Changes During Rhizogenesis in Callus Cultures of Tribulus Terrestris Linn

Singh M et al.
8/1/2015

Biochemical changes during in vitro root formation in Tribulus terrestris were investigated in the callus derived from nodal explants on Murashige and Skoog’s (MS) medium supplemented with 1.0 mg/l 2,4-D+ 0.5 mg/l Kinetin. The callus maintained on MS medium fortified with 2.0 mg/l 2, 4-dichlorophenoxy acetic acid (2,4-D) + 0.5 mg/l Kinetin. The above callus subcultured on Murashige and Skoog’s (MS) medium + 2.0 mg/l α-naphthalene acetic acid (NAA). Metabolites like starch and total; soluble sugars decreased while reducing sugar, total phenol and total protein increased during root differentiation in callus. Enzyme activity viz. α-amylase, acid invertase, peroxidase and acid phosphatase increased during root differentiation.
